Eastern Aids Support Triangle - EAST

16-17 St Marks Street
Peterborough
Cambridgeshire
PE1 2TU

25.0 miles away

EAST works with iCASH in Peterborough and delivers prevention programmes to minority and hard to reach communities in the city. Projects in Peterborough include outreach to MSM in local venues, a training programme for Eastern European and other minority communities, and an LGBTQI youth group.
